Mahabharata Vana Parva – मेध्यारण्यं स गत्वा च दयुमत्सेनाश्रमं नृपः

Shloka (श्लोक)

मेध्यारण्यं स गत्वा च दयुमत्सेनाश्रमं नृपः
पद्भ्याम एव दविजैः सार्धं राजर्षिं तम उपागमत

⚡ Quick Meaning

This verse narrates how the king traveled to a sacred place to seek blessings for his daughter’s marriage.

Translations

English Translation

The king, after reaching the holy place of Medhya and visiting the hermitage of Dayumatsen, approached the revered sage there. This emphasizes the significance of sacred locations in fulfilling spiritual rituals.

हिंदी अनुवाद

राजा, मेध्यारण्य नामक पवित्र स्थान पर पहुँचकर दयुमत्सेन के आश्रम में गया और वहाँ के प्रतिष्ठित ऋषि से मिला। यह आध्यात्मिक अनुष्ठानों में पवित्र स्थानों के महत्व को उजागर करता है।
